Technical Considerations and Cautions

While Mask Logo Line Art Simple Minimalist is robust, there are areas where you must proceed with caution. As an experienced designer, I always warn fellow crafters about thin lines. If you are using this for a crowded composition, the delicate nature of the line art might get lost. Avoid placing it over busy patterns or low-contrast colors. For example, a grey mask on a navy blue shirt will vanish. Always test your colors before committing to a full production run.

Additionally, be mindful of layered vinyl projects. Because this is a single-line style, it does not lend itself well to multi-layered 3D effects unless you creatively duplicate and offset the path, which can look messy if not done precisely. For small sticker sizes, ensure you simplify the layout if you add any accompanying text, as readability is key.

File Formats and Workflow Tips

The download includes EPS, SVG, PDF, and JPG files. For the best result, try to open the EPS file using Adobe Illustrator if you have access to it. This allows you to manipulate the anchor points directly. The package notes that the text is non-editable, but you can change vector-based designs as you wish. This is a crucial distinction. You cannot simply type over the existing text if there were any, but you can resize, recolor, and reshape the mask illustration itself.

Here are my practical notes for integrating this into your workflow:

  1. Test the File: Before selling finished products, do a test cut. Check if SVG lines are clean and closed.
  2. Preview Transparency: Always preview the PNG transparency to ensure no white halos remain around the edges.
  3. Confirm Resolution: For sublimation, confirm the resolution is at least 300 DPI to avoid pixelation on large mugs.
  4. Mockup Placement: Place the design on real mockups. See how it looks on both white and dark products. You may need to create a reverse (white) version for dark garments.
  5. Typography Pairing: Since the graphic is minimal, pair it with a strong font. A bold sans serif font creates a modern look, while a delicate script font adds a feminine touch. Avoid overly decorative display fonts that might compete with the line art.
  6. Licensing Check: Always confirm commercial licensing before using it for customer orders. Even if it is listed under Freebies, ensure the license permits sale of physical goods.
